What Is Ikigai, and How Does It Translate Into Design?

Ikigai is a Japanese concept that means “a reason for being” — the joy of finding purpose in life. In graphic terms, this idea is communicated through natural forms, calm colors, balanced compositions, and elegant simplicity.

This collection was created for those who seek more than decoration — for those who want to convey meaning through design. It’s a perfect visual tool for expressing the values of Japanese culture.

What’s Inside the Ikigai Collection?

The set includes over 160 vector and raster elements, thoughtfully grouped for creative flexibility:

  • 46 Ikigai Elements — abstract symbols, ideal for logos and visual identity
  • 52 Floral Ornaments — blooming branches, petals, circular motifs
  • 50 Decorative Shapes — Japanese-style lines, brushwork, textures
  • 20 Japanese Patterns — seamless backgrounds in 3600 × 3600 px, 300 DPI

All assets come in AI, EPS, PNG formats (with transparent backgrounds), and patterns also include JPG versions.
